Can a Denon AVR 2106 Amp be reset? If so, how? I have tried holding the two buttons down (speaker A & B) while switching on the ON button, this goes through a lot of flashing on the display but I the still get the Red flashing error around the On button. Can anyone help? Its only a month old?

Try unplugging the unit from the AC outlet for about 30 minutes.

thank you for the suggestion we have tried this. we also have dissconected all speaker cables and input lines and the red stand by light keeps flashing rapidly .

Check your manual.

If it's like the older Denons, you have to push a particular button(s) on the front of the unit and keep them depressed while you or someone else unplugs and plugs the unit back in.
